Summary of Position: 

The Registered Nurse (RN) is responsible for providing competent, quality,skilled nursing services in accordance with the individual child’s physician Plan of Care and ongoing physician orders. All care is delivered in compliance with the state specific Registered Nurse Practice Act and HealthCare for Kids company Policies and Procedures. The Registered Nurse communicates collaboratively and effectively with other healthcare professionals and the individual child’s family.

Physical Requirements and Work Environment: 

  • Environment: Work is performed primarily in a Prescribed Pediatric Extended Care setting with extensive patient contact. Due to the nature of the work, the RN may be exposed to bodily fluids and odors on an occasional basis. 
  • Physical: Primary functions require sufficient physical ability and mobility to work with a patient; to stand or sit for prolonged periods of time; to occasionally stoop, bend, kneel, crouch, reach, and twist; to lift, carry, push, and/or pull light to moderate amounts of weight (up to 30 lbs.); and to verbally communicate to exchange information. 
  • Vision: Close vision, distance vision, peripheral vision, depth perception, and the ability to adjust focus. 
  • Hearing: Hear in a normal audio range, with or without correction.
